What is a "siren"?

arrow

A siren is an aquatic salamander characterized by its elongated body, lack of hind limbs, and external gills. They inhabit freshwater habitats such as swamps, ponds, and rivers, often hiding in vegetation or burrowing in mud. Sirens are primarily nocturnal and feed on small invertebrates and sometimes small fish. They have a unique ability to breathe through their external gills and can remain submerged for long periods. With their secretive nature and adaptability to aquatic environments, sirens contribute to the diversity and ecological balance of their habitats.
